Sky Player, Sky’s online TV service, will be introduced to Xbox Live in late October, Microsoft has confirmed.
“October 27 - that's the date when you'll be able to watch TV from Sky on your Xbox 360,” said Graeme Boyd, Microsoft Europe's Xbox community manager.
Announced in May, the service will allow Xbox 360 owners to access a range of channels and programmes to view live or on-demand. Content will initially be offered in standard definition only, and won’t be recordable.
While Boyd said that the "channel line-up and pricing [are] to come at launch”, users can expect to be able to access movies and entertainment shows, as well as documentaries and programming dedicated to kids, music, the arts and sport, including Premier League football and Test Match cricket.
